Properties of Silicone Materials and Their Applications in Industry

Hits: 553 img


Silicone materials, with their unique chemical structure and properties, have been widely used in industrial fields. This article explores the characteristics of silicone materials and their main applications.

Characteristics

The backbone of silicone materials consists of silicon-oxygen bonds (Si-O-Si), which provide excellent heat resistance, weather resistance, and chemical stability. Additionally, silicone materials have low surface tension, high breathability, and good electrical insulation properties.

Industrial Applications

  1. Construction Industry: Silicone sealants and waterproof coatings are widely used for building joints and roof waterproofing.

  2. Automotive Industry: Silicone rubber is used to manufacture high-temperature-resistant seals and hoses.

  3. Electronics Industry: Silicone materials are used as encapsulants and insulators for electronic components.

  4. Medical Industry: Due to their biocompatibility, silicone materials are used to manufacture medical devices and implants.

Future Outlook

With technological advancements, silicone materials will find applications in more fields, such as new energy and environmental protection.
